前言到了年底果然都不太平,最近又收到了运维报警:表示有些服务器负载非常高,让我们定位问题。还真是想什么来什么,前些天还故意把某些服务器的负载提高(没错,老板让我写个BUG!),不过还好是不同的环境互相没有影响。定位问题拿到问题后首先去服务器上看了看,发现运行的只有我们的Java应用。于是先用ps命令拿到了应用的PID。接着使用ps-Hppid将这个进程的线程显示出来。输入大写的P可以将线程按照CP
分类:
其他好文 时间:
2020-12-16 12:56:49
阅读次数:
7
前言最近这段时间确实有点忙,这篇的目录还是在飞机上敲出来了的。言归正传,上周更新了cim第一版:为自己搭建一个分布式的IM系统。没想到反响热烈,最高时上了GitHubTrendingJava版块的首位,一天收到了300+的star。现在总共也有1.3K+的star,有几十个朋友参加了测试,非常感谢大家的支持。在这过程中也收到一些bug反馈,feature建议;因此这段时间我把一些影响较大的bug以
分类:
编程语言 时间:
2020-12-16 12:55:58
阅读次数:
6
游戏项目研发时,期望搭建自动化测试平台,发现局内bug,避免重复劳动、提高测试效率以及避免人为的操作错误。其中环境要求使用项目需要使用Airtest、poco对接强化学习的服务器,实现Airtest将状态信息发送给服务器,服务器返回下一步的决策。 1. 前期准备工作 了解Airtest、poco、强 ...
分类:
其他好文 时间:
2020-12-15 12:57:54
阅读次数:
10
1.前言 目前我主要负责的是公司的营销活动类项目,基本都是直接面向用户端的,并且JS也没有如后端一样有完善的日志系统,因此线上的各种bug都非常难以迅速定位。在加入错误日志收集前,每次报告bug都要劳烦用户协助开发人员进行bug定位,这一方面对用户极不友好,同时也加大了Bug定位的难度;因此我们需要 ...
分类:
其他好文 时间:
2020-12-15 12:16:35
阅读次数:
3
1.Sentry是什么? Sentry是一个异常日志集中收集系统。 英文意思:警卫 2.Sentry有什么用? 它可以捕捉到stack trace,stack locals,proceding event和引发该异常的commit号。 当bug fix后,Sentry会自动追踪上次异常是否在本次提交 ...
分类:
其他好文 时间:
2020-12-14 13:51:31
阅读次数:
5
需求: 在做公司文件共享系统的项目的时候,遇到个单次上传最大个数10的需求。 过程: 去翻了文档,看到limit这个属性,美滋滋的加上了。自测了下,选择11个确实执行了on-exceed对应的方法,提示出来超出限制。 提测阶段: 测试突然说我这个限制有bug,最后测试确实是存在bug,原因是文档这个 ...
分类:
Web程序 时间:
2020-12-14 13:38:53
阅读次数:
7
今天做插件开发遇到一个很奇怪问题,项目build完全正常,clean时报错,莫名其妙,报错信息如下: Information:Gradle tasks [clean, :app:generateDebugSources, :app:generateDebugAndroidTestSources, : ...
分类:
移动开发 时间:
2020-12-11 12:42:03
阅读次数:
28
一、docker存在的安全问题 docker自身漏洞 作为一款应用 Docker 本身实现上会有代码缺陷。CVE官方记录Docker历史版本共有超过20项漏洞。黑客常用的攻击手段主要有代码执行、权限提升、 信息泄露、权限绕过等。目前 Docker 版本更迭非常快,Docker 用户最好将 Docke ...
分类:
其他好文 时间:
2020-12-11 12:41:04
阅读次数:
25
高级驾驶辅助系统(ADAS)是汽车电子创新的关键领域,但是只有在它们像其他安全关键型软件一样经历了同样程度的严苛测试时,其在安全方面的提升和积极影响才能得以实现。ISO 26262定义了汽车功能安全的设计和构建准则,其中包含ADAS系统。按照标准,静态分析在软件开发中起着重要作用。本文讨论了静态分析 ...
分类:
其他好文 时间:
2020-12-11 12:24:44
阅读次数:
5
人无完人,对于程序员来说,写出有 bug 的代码是在所难免的 。 下面 程序员在修复 bug 时可能会说的一些话或者想法 ,你占了几条?赶紧一起来看看。 1. “就因为忘记加个分号,整个程序都崩溃了” 我用过的每一种编程语言几乎都需要行终止符,当然并不是所有的都需要,但 C/C++ 族编程语言通常是 ...
分类:
其他好文 时间:
2020-12-11 12:19:49
阅读次数:
5